The hotels en Iceland they vary in size, location, and personality. There are international chains in Reykjavik, and hotels operated by families, especially in the field. Some include a breakfast buffet in the price, others do not. Most will have parking and will assist you with tours and excursions.

The hotels urban areas are well located in areas of restaurants, shops and attractions. In addition, they open throughout the year. In the case of the rural ones, many work only in summer, but they have an excellent view from the rooms: the ocean, the hills, rivers and mountains.

The Bed & Breakfast they are smaller than hotels, but are almost always in quiet neighborhoods. They offer breakfast and provide all the facilities for you to prepare your own meals. Only one or two rooms come with a private kitchen. They are generally only open during the summer.

If you want to get away from urban life, farms in Iceland they are a comfortable and economical option. There are more than 150 farms offering about 4,000 beds. They include food and activities — like horseback riding, fishing, hunting, and even playing golf. You can stay in the farmhouse or stay in one of the summer houses built on the property. These can accommodate up to twelve people. There is a central reservation office. Its website is:

To be more in contact with nature, there are 125 sites of camping. Most of them are open between June and August, sometimes until mid-September depending on your location. The price of camping in national parks supervised by the Natural Conservation Council is 5 euros for adults and free of charge for children. Others cost between 4 and 6 euros depending on the amenities they offer (showers, washing machines, kitchens, etc.). We recommend you book in advance as it is a very common activity among Icelanders. Camping outside of designated sites is illegal.
